Comstock Inc
Comstock, Inc. engages in the exploration and development of mineral properties. The company is headquartered in Virginia City, Nevada and currently employs 33 full-time employees. The company went IPO on 2002-02-28. The Company’s segments include renewable energy, metals and mining, and strategic and corporate investments. The Renewable Energy segment consists of technology and engineering services sales, licenses, royalties, demonstration plants and equipment, and research and development expenses. Its technologies include cellulosic fuels and electrification products. The company converts wasted and unused biomass feedstock into cellulosic ethanol and drop-in fuels. Its technologies are designed to crush, separate, and condition every class of lithium-ion battery feedstock together with their host devices and other electrification materials for unrivaled client flexibility.

Debt-Free Balance Sheet: Comstock eliminated all debt as of September 30, 2025, compared to $8.5 million a year ago, creating one of its strongest financial positions ever.
Equity Raise: The company completed an oversubscribed equity offering this quarter, netting $31.8 million in proceeds and bringing in over 30 new institutional investors.
Solar Recycling Ramp: Significant progress was made on scaling the solar panel recycling business, with equipment deposits placed, key permits nearly secured, and first facility commissioning expected in Q1 2026.
Revenue In Line: Third quarter billings were about $0.5 million, keeping Comstock on track for its full-year guidance of $3.5 million.
Growth Strategy: Cash from Plant 1 will go toward expanding recycling capacity, with additional facilities in site selection and planned for 2027 and 2028.
No Further Dilution: Management stated there are no plans to issue more shares to fund mining or core business operations.
Bioleum Separation: Bioleum Corporation was spun off and is now self-funded, with Comstock retaining a controlling stake.
Mining Monetization: High gold prices have led to increased outside interest in Comstock’s mining assets, with ongoing work toward potential joint ventures or sales.
